Graphic Designer CV vs Portfolio — What You Need Both

As a graphic designer, your portfolio is your most powerful sales tool — but your CV is what gets your portfolio seen. Recruiters and hiring managers decide whether to click your portfolio link based on your CV. Your CV must clearly communicate your specialisation (branding, packaging, digital, motion, UX), the tools you master, the calibre of clients you've worked with, and your design philosophy. What to Include in a Graphic Designer CV

Key sections: a strong personal statement with your design speciality and philosophy; a Software & Tools section (Adobe Creative Suite — Illustrator, Photoshop, InDesign, After Effects; Figma; Sketch; Procreate; Blender); Work Experience with specific campaigns, brand identities, or projects you owned; Education (degree, bootcamp, or self-taught path — all valid); Awards and recognition; and your Portfolio URL prominently in the header. Mention client names and industries served — "Designed brand identity for a Series B fintech startup" is far more compelling than "Worked on branding projects."

ATS and the Creative CV Problem

Many graphic designers make CVs that look stunning but completely fail ATS screening — heavy on graphics, columns, icons, and unusual fonts that automated systems can't parse. Freelance Design Work on Your CV

Freelance experience is fully valid and should be presented professionally. Create a "Freelance Graphic Designer" role entry covering your freelance period with a bulleted list of notable clients and project types. Example: "Freelance Graphic Designer (2022–Present) — Clients include: Noon.com (social media campaign assets), Dubai Tourism Board (event branding), three Series A startups (full brand identity). Deliverables included visual identity systems, pitch deck design, and digital ad creative." This framing communicates volume, variety, and client quality effectively.
